The Antiquarian Book Trade Association (ABTA) Guides are comprehensive resources designed to support professionals, collectors, and enthusiasts in the antiquarian book trade. These guides offer valuable insights into industry standards, valuation methods, preservation techniques, and best practices for buying and selling rare and collectible books. They serve as an authoritative reference within the antiquarian book community, promoting ethical practices and facilitating informed decision-making.
